Vendor note for new team members: canary gating on the Bramblewick platform is enforced by our vendor, Opaline Systems, not by us. Their Gatewright tool holds each canary at 5% traffic until error rate, latency p95, and saturation all pass for 30 minutes. We cannot override the hold; only Opaline's release desk can. Document any gating dispute in the vendor log before requesting an exception. For exception requests, write to their release desk directly.

alerts address for bahaf-kaduf: zorox@qorvelio.internal

Handover note — Crumbwheel order cutoffs.

Welcome aboard. The bakery cutoff rule in Crumbwheel closes same-day orders at 14:00 local to each storefront, not UTC — this has bitten us twice. Holiday overrides live in the calendar service and take precedence silently, so always check there first when a cutoff looks wrong. To unlock the calendar service's admin console after a restart, enter the recovery passphrase below.

vault phrase of bagap-bahaf = silion-pelox-sorox-casdor-quenwyn-fraax-eliox-praael-kelion-quenvan-kasox-rusael-norius-belvan

Step 3 of the Hoistline migration covers the dispatch-simulator core. Carefully export existing scenario libraries before upgrading, since the new engine rewrites manifest schemas in place and cannot roll back. Run the compatibility checker against every saved building profile; flag failures for the sync. Once all profiles validate cleanly, bring up the new engine using the configuration values given below.

deployment values, kahof-yadug:
[gorys]
team = silael
access_code = ac_00d620
owner = istox.oliys
host = gorys.torvastack.example
port = 9000
peer = holmir.merlaqsoft.example
salt = 9fdae78a
pin = 2358